Kerry Washington and Roland Emmerich were honored Saturday at GLAAD's 26th annual Media Awards held at the Beverly Hilton in Los Angeles.

Washington (Scandal) was presented with the group's Vanguard Award by Ellen DeGeneres, while Channing Tatum presented out director Roland Emmerich (Independence Day) with the group's Stephen F. Kolzak Award.

In accepting the group's award for Best Comedy Series, Transparent producer Jill Soloway remarked “GLAAD makes the world safer for people to walk out of their front door.”

The Imitation Game won in the Outstanding Film – Wide Release category, while the ABC drama How to Get Away with Murder picked up the Outstanding Drama Series prize.
